Automated follow-up on missed appointments or absences

Purpose

1.1. Automate multi-channel follow-up when an adult day care participant misses a scheduled visit, absence is noted, or necessary attendance is not registered.
1.2. Notify family, caregivers, and relevant staff using timely, accurate communication, escalating to supervisors or case workers if required.
1.3. Log all messaging, response collection, and escalation activities for compliance, reporting, and quality assurance.
1.4. Enable rapid coordination for welfare checks, rescheduling, transport assistance, or health follow-ups.

Trigger Conditions

2.1. Absence recorded in participant attendance software after a configurable cutoff.
2.2. Manual press of ‘missed attendee’ by frontline staff on digital sign-in.
2.3. Lack of sign-in data submitted by remote check-in device or app.
2.4. Direct sync failures between client management system and attendance logs.

Platform Variants

3.1. Twilio SMS
- Feature: Programmable Messaging; configure outbound SMS to family number, sample: “Missed appointment at [Center]. Reply YES for call back.” API: POST /Messages
3.2. SendGrid
- Feature: Transactional Email API; set up trigger-driven absentee email notifications. Sample: endpoint sends templated HTML emails to contacts.
3.3. Slack
- Feature: Incoming Webhooks; send auto-alerts to staff or management channels upon missed attendance records.
3.4. Microsoft Teams
- Feature: Adaptive Cards, Webhook; push actionable alerts and escalation forms directly to Teams channels.
3.5. Gmail API
- Feature: Automated Compose & Send; pre-fill and send missed-appointment notification email to emergency contacts.
3.6. Outlook 365 API
- Feature: CreateEvent, SendMail; send alerts and prompt calendar rescheduling for family/staff.
3.7. WhatsApp Business API
- Feature: Session Message; send templated messages to emergency contacts for real-time acknowledgment.
3.8. PagerDuty
- Feature: API Trigger; auto-create escalation incident for high-risk no-shows requiring immediate intervention.
3.9. FrontApp
- Feature: API-triggered Shared Inbox Message; route absentee inquiries to team for unified reply.
3.10. Aircall
- Feature: Initiate Call Post; trigger API to automatically call emergency contact if SMS/email unacknowledged after timeout.
3.11. Intercom
- Feature: Outbound Messaging API; send in-app and email follow-ups to authorized caregivers.
3.12. Salesforce
- Feature: Process Builder, Flow; automated case creation and communication logging for missed attendance.
3.13. HubSpot
- Feature: Automated Workflows; configure sequence for message delivery and failure escalation through multiple channels.
3.14. Zoho CRM
- Feature: Custom Functions; auto-generate activities and email workflows triggered by absence record.
3.15. Mailgun
- Feature: Messages API; send personalized absentee emails, track opens/responses for follow-up chains.
3.16. Vonage
- Feature: SMS and Voice API; dual-mode outreach if first message goes unanswered.
3.17. RingCentral
- Feature: Message/Call API; schedule reminders or welfare checks by phone.
3.18. Google Sheets
- Feature: Sheets API; log triggers, notifications, and responses for compliance and audit.
3.19. Airtable
- Feature: Automations; track absentee events, trigger notifications from base updates.
3.20. Zapier
- Feature: Multi-step Automation; combine triggers (from calendars, sign-in apps) with notification and escalation steps among above platforms.

Benefits

4.1. Increases family engagement and safety oversight by automating routine checks.
4.2. Reduces manual admin workload for care staff and minimizes human error in urgent cases.
4.3. Improves compliance with care standards and documentation requirements.
4.4. Enables rapid response workflow—from notification to escalation—without staff intervention.
4.5. Integrates seamlessly with mixed communication preferences: SMS, email, in-app, and calls.
